Charles Edmund Thompson, known as Chuck Thompson, (June 4, 1926 – March 7, 1982) was an American jazz drummer active in California and New York City during the 1940s and 1950s. While he made many recordings, jazz critic Leonard Feather stated, "Chuck Thompson, who sounded good enough on records, is even more memorable live. He is an unusually spare, functional drummer who does not lean on his top cymbal all night, whose accessories are just that, and who possesses an unfailing sense of time."[1]
